In terms of its working principle, the principle of operation for a single diode is simple. When a potential difference is applied across the p-n junction of the diode, free electrons in the n-type semiconductor material are attracted towards the positively-charged p-type semiconductor material. This process is called forward biasing and it causes current to flow from the p-type region to the n-type region. When the same potential difference is applied to the diode in the opposite direction, the electrons are pushed away from the semiconductor junction and current flow stops.
